Introduction to pH and H+

pH is a measure of the concentration of hydrogen ions (H+) in a solution, which determines its acidity or basicity. The pH scale ranges from 0 to 14, with a pH of 7 being neutral (neither acidic nor basic). A pH less than 7 indicates an acidic solution, while a pH greater than 7 indicates a basic solution. The relationship between pH and H+ is governed by the following equation: pH = -log[H+], where [H+] is the concentration of hydrogen ions in moles per liter (M).

The pH Scale and its Significance

The pH scale is a logarithmic scale, meaning that each whole number change in pH represents a tenfold change in hydrogen ion concentration. For example, a solution with a pH of 6 has a tenfold higher concentration of hydrogen ions than a solution with a pH of 7. This logarithmic relationship makes the pH scale a convenient way to express the acidity or basicity of a solution.

pH and H+ Concentration: A Mathematical Relationship

The mathematical relationship between pH and H+ concentration is given by the equation: pH = -log[H+]. This equation can be rearranged to solve for [H+]: [H+] = 10^(-pH). This equation shows that the concentration of hydrogen ions (H+) is inversely proportional to the pH of the solution. As the pH increases, the concentration of hydrogen ions decreases, and vice versa.

Calculating H+ from pH

Now that we have a clear understanding of the relationship between pH and H+, let’s explore how to calculate H+ from pH. The calculation involves using the equation: [H+] = 10^(-pH). This equation can be used to calculate the concentration of hydrogen ions (H+) in a solution, given its pH.

A Step-by-Step Guide to Calculating H+ from pH

To calculate H+ from pH, follow these steps:
Use a calculator to enter the pH value.
Change the sign of the pH value (i.e., make it negative).
Raise 10 to the power of the negative pH value.
The result will be the concentration of hydrogen ions (H+) in moles per liter (M).

For example, if the pH of a solution is 4.5, the concentration of hydrogen ions (H+) can be calculated as follows:
[H+] = 10^(-4.5)
[H+] = 10^(-4.5) = 3.16 x 10^(-5) M

How do I calculate the H+ concentration from pH?

To calculate the H+ concentration from pH, you can use the formula: H+ (M) = 10^(-pH). This formula is derived from the definition of pH as the negative logarithm of the H+ concentration. For example, if the pH of a solution is 4, you can calculate the H+ concentration as follows: H+ (M) = 10^(-4) = 0.0001 M. This means that the solution has a hydrogen ion concentration of 0.0001 moles per liter.

It is essential to note that the H+ concentration is usually expressed in scientific notation, which can be unfamiliar to some individuals. However, with practice and experience, calculating the H+ concentration from pH becomes a straightforward process. Additionally, many calculators and online tools are available to simplify the calculation and reduce the risk of errors. What are the limitations of using pH to determine H+ concentration?

While pH is a convenient and widely used measure of H+ concentration, it has some limitations. One major limitation is that pH is a logarithmic scale, which means that small changes in pH can correspond to large changes in H+ concentration. For instance, a change in pH from 4 to 5 represents a tenfold decrease in H+ concentration. This non-linear relationship can make it challenging to interpret and compare pH values, especially for individuals without a strong background in chemistry.

Another limitation of using pH to determine H+ concentration is that it assumes a simple aqueous solution with a single proton donor or acceptor. In reality, many solutions are complex and contain multiple ions, molecules, and other species that can interact with hydrogen ions. These interactions can affect the pH and H+ concentration, leading to deviations from the expected values. Furthermore, pH measurements can be influenced by factors such as temperature, ionic strength, and the presence of interfering substances. By recognizing these limitations, individuals can use pH and H+ concentration with caution and consider additional factors when interpreting and applying these values.

What is the difference between pH and pOH, and how do they relate to H+ concentration?

pH and pOH are two related but distinct measures of the acidity or basicity of a solution. While pH is a measure of the H+ concentration, pOH is a measure of the hydroxide ion (OH-) concentration. The relationship between pH and pOH is inversely related, meaning that as pH increases, pOH decreases, and vice versa. The sum of pH and pOH is always equal to 14 at 25°C, which is known as the water dissociation constant (Kw).

The relationship between pH, pOH, and H+ concentration is based on the autoionization of water, which produces equal amounts of H+ and OH- ions. In a neutral solution, the concentrations of H+ and OH- ions are equal, and the pH and pOH values are both 7. In acidic or basic solutions, the concentrations of H+ and OH- ions deviate from equality, resulting in different pH and pOH values. How do I choose the correct pH buffer for my application?

Choosing the correct pH buffer for a specific application depends on several factors, including the desired pH range, the type of solution, and the presence of interfering substances. pH buffers are solutions that resist changes in pH when acids or bases are added, and they are commonly used in laboratory settings, industrial processes, and biological systems. The most common pH buffers are phosphate, acetate, and Tris buffers, each with its own pH range and limitations.

When selecting a pH buffer, it is essential to consider the pKa value of the buffering agent, which is the pH at which the buffering agent is 50% ionized. The pKa value should be close to the desired pH range to ensure effective buffering. Additionally, individuals should consider the concentration of the buffering agent, the ionic strength of the solution, and the presence of other ions or substances that may interact with the buffering agent. By carefully selecting the correct pH buffer, individuals can maintain a stable pH environment, which is critical for many chemical reactions, biological processes, and industrial applications.
